
Death in a White Tie (1938) by Ngaio Marsh is the seventh novel in her Inspector Roderick Alleyn series. Set during London’s debutante season, the story begins with a body found in the back of a taxi. Alleyn investigates a blackmailer targeting society women, but the case turns tragic when his trusted friend Lord Robert Gospell is murdered. The novel is considered one of Marsh’s finest works from the 1930s, combining elegant social settings with a tightly constructed mystery.
